The goal of this build is to try and get the most out of both fighter and ranger levels, and allow the possibility to reach 15 ranger by level 20. By taking 12 levels of ranger I get the best of the ranger buffs, all of the free feats that I need for TWF, 3 favored enemies and all but one of the enhancements for favored enemy. By taking 4 levels of fighter, I can take weapon focus and specialization for an additional +1 to hit and +2 to damage on all targets.
I'd like to check that the core of my build makes sense before proceeding.

Everything else is item-dependent.
It seemed logical that with mid-300 projected hit points and 24-26 dex at 16, evasion and light armor would serve me better than MFP.
Dex 14 base +3 ranger enhancements +1 human +2 tome +6 item = 26 maximum projected. 24 should be eay to reach
STR will receive the most attention with
18 base +4 levels +1 fighter, +1 human, +2 1750 tome, + 6 item = 32
Madstone boots, Rams Might, Rage potion = 38
Stunning Blow or OTWF may turn into IC: Pierce or Toughness
